Transaction d8a3f641eee7871999d5ae33e31ca4421a70596b202a4f0c83771b2b7ad4ae47
1 Input
1 Output
-
d8a3f641eee7871999d5ae33e31ca4421a70596b202a4f0c83771b2b7ad4ae47:0
- value
- 129554
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d58d26587997ee60b6acb3e8bc9829c0b55d415 OP_EQUAL
- address
- 34NBvZKJTvVJATJEczcGoJKqEvkehtUCGc